rep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Clean up some clang-tidy warnings in the router
2024-05-03
Chris Robinson
Clean
up some
cla
n
g-tidy warnings in the router
commit
|
commitdiff
|
tree
2024-05-03
C
hris
R
ob
i
nson
Use
std::unordered_map
for th
e
h
a
n
d
le
-
>
i
n
dex map
commit
|
commitdiff
|
tree
2024-05-02
Chr
i
s
R
obinson
Dec
l
are variables closer to
w
here the
y
'
r
e
us
e
d
commit
|
commitdiff
|
tree
2024-05-02
Chris
R
obinson
Check ALROUTER_ACCE
P
T/
R
E
JECT f
o
r dlls to acce
p
t/reject
commit
|
commitdiff
|
tree
2024-05-02
Chris
R
obinson
A
void fixed-length p
a
th
s
in the
r
outer
commit
|
commitdiff
|
tree
2024-05-02
Chr
i
s Robinson
Handle
a
public priv
a
te e
n
um val
u
e
in
t
he
ALSA
b
ackend
commit
|
commitdiff
|
tree
2024-05-01
Chris Robinson
Convert a few
m
ore l
o
ops to a
l
g
o
rithms
commit
|
commitdiff
|
tree
2024-05-01
C
h
ris Robins
o
n
F
i
x reve
r
b main delay fad
i
ng
commit
|
commitdiff
|
tree
2024-05-01
Chris Robi
n
son
Replace a c
o
uple
l
o
ops w
i
th algorithms
commit
|
commitdiff
|
tree
2024-04-27
Chris Robins
o
n
U
s
e std::tran
s
form in the mixers instead
o
f loo
p
s
commit
|
commitdiff
|
tree
2024-04-26
Chris Robinson
Ensure the
c
o
nte
x
t is connected when pro
b
ing
Pul
s
eAu
d
io
.
.
.
commit
|
commitdiff
|
tree
2024-04-22
Chris
Robi
n
son
U
s
e a span to reg
i
ster JACK ports
commit
|
commitdiff
|
tree
2024-04-22
Ch
r
is Robinson
Avoid i
n
ter
l
a
c
ed
mixing
for
the non-RT JA
C
K mixin
g
commit
|
commitdiff
|
tree
2024-04-20
Chr
i
s Robinson
Replace a loo
p
wi
t
h a cou
p
le alg
o
rithms
commit
|
commitdiff
|
tree
2024-04-20
C
h
ris Rob
i
nson
Remove an unde
s
ireable cast
commit
|
commitdiff
|
tree
2024-04-18
Chris R
o
bin
s
on
R
e
du
c
e
t
h
e number
of mutable
v
ariables in t
h
e rever
b
.
.
.
commit
|
commitdiff
|
tree
2024-04-16
Chri
s
Ro
b
inson
Use
spa
n
s
more in the
r
everb e
f
fect
commit
|
commitdiff
|
tree
2024-04-16
Chris Rob
i
n
s
on
Fix an implic
i
t
array-to-pointer
d
e
ca
y
commit
|
commitdiff
|
tree
2024-04-15
Chris Robinson
Add
m
i
s
s
ing inc
l
u
de
commit
|
commitdiff
|
tree
2024-04-15
C
h
ris Robi
n
s
on
R
ename SoundIO to SndIO
commit
|
commitdiff
|
tree
2024-04-15
C
h
ris Robinson
Rename FindSoundIO
.
cmake to
FindSn
d
IO
.
cmake
commit
|
commitdiff
|
tree
2024-04-15
Chris Robinson
Disable Sn
d
IO
by default
o
n non-BS
D
syst
e
ms
commit
|
commitdiff
|
tree
2024-04-14
Chris R
o
binson
Cl
a
r
i
fy
a
log message
commit
|
commitdiff
|
tree
2024-04-14
Chris
Robinson
C
l
ean u
p
s
o
me assert
s
a
nd add an alasser
t
commit
|
commitdiff
|
tree
2024-04-13
C
hris Robinson
Simplify PortA
u
d
io device enumeration
commit
|
commitdiff
|
tree
2024-04-09
Chris Robinson
Replace
a set
of ifs with
a
switch
commit
|
commitdiff
|
tree
2024-04-09
Chris Ro
b
inson
S
im
p
lify sort
i
ng
n
ew
elements
commit
|
commitdiff
|
tree
2024-04-09
C
hris Robinson
Remove unnecessary N
O
LINT c
o
mme
n
ts
commit
|
commitdiff
|
tree
2024-04-09
Chris Robinson
Clean
u
p some
t
e
m
p
o
rary span definitions
commit
|
commitdiff
|
tree
2024-04-09
Chris Ro
b
inson
Avoid call
i
ng std::max in alignas
commit
|
commitdiff
|
tree
2024-04-07
Chris Robinson
Up
d
ate App
V
eyo
r
to
VS
2022
commit
|
commitdiff
|
tree
2024-04-07
Ch
r
i
s Robinson
Add e
n
umerati
o
n to the
P
ortAudio
backend
commit
|
commitdiff
|
tree
2024-04-07
Chris Rob
i
n
s
on
Allo
w
specify other cha
n
nel counts
f
or PortA
u
d
i
o playback
commit
|
commitdiff
|
tree
2024-04-07
Chris
Robinson
(
Re
-
)add
a
cubic s
p
line
r
e
sampler
commit
|
commitdiff
|
tree
2024-04-07
Chri
s
Robinson
R
e
n
ame
the cubic resampler to g
a
ussi
a
n
commit
|
commitdiff
|
tree
2024-04-06
Chris R
o
binson
Pa
s
s spans t
o
th
e
re
s
amplers
instead of po
i
nte
r
s to
.
.
.
commit
|
commitdiff
|
tree
2024-04-05
Chris Robin
s
on
Fix i
m
pl
i
c
i
t sign
e
dness
c
o
n
versi
o
n warnin
g
s o
n
3
2
-
b
i
t
commit
|
commitdiff
|
tree
2024-04-04
Chris Robinson
A
v
oid more raw poi
n
ter manipu
l
a
tion in uhj
f
i
l
ter
commit
|
commitdiff
|
tree
2024-04-03
C
h
ris Robins
o
n
Be a bit s
a
fer and
less ex
p
licit with span
s
commit
|
commitdiff
|
tree
2024-04-02
Chris Robinson
Use
s
p
ans in
p
l
a
c
e of some po
i
nter and iterator ma
n
ipulation
commit
|
commitdiff
|
tree
2024-03-31
Chris
Robinson
Round
up the HRI
R
length for the
S
IM
D
HRTF
f
ilter
commit
|
commitdiff
|
tree
2024-03-30
Ch
r
is Robinson
Remov
e
a couple infe
r
red t
e
mp
l
ate parameters
commit
|
commitdiff
|
tree
2024-03-30
Chris Robin
s
on
Inline a
c
ouple m
o
re globals
commit
|
commitdiff
|
tree
2024-03-30
Chris
R
obinson
Pass span
s
to
t
he HRTF mixer
f
unctions instead of poin
t
ers
commit
|
commitdiff
|
tree
2024-03-30
C
h
ris Ro
b
ins
o
n
Pass spans to th
e
m
ixer fu
n
ctions instead of pointers
commit
|
commitdiff
|
tree
2024-03-30
Chris R
o
binson
Remove some unneces
s
ary REST
R
I
C
T
u
s
es
commit
|
commitdiff
|
tree
2024-03-29
Chr
i
s
Robinso
n
Assert for out-
o
f-bounds
s
u
bspans in
s
tead
of t
h
row
i
ng
commit
|
commitdiff
|
tree
2024-03-29
Chris Ro
b
inson
Minor c
l
e
a
n up of som
e
st
d
::g
e
nerate calls
commit
|
commitdiff
|
tree
2024-03-29
Chris Robinson
A
dd an
a
l
dir
e
ct example for the
D
irect e
x
tensi
o
n
commit
|
commitdiff
|
tree
2024-03-28
Chris Ro
b
inson
Do 4 sample
s
at a tim
e
i
n
PhaseShifte
r
T
:
:
p
roces
s
f
o
r
.
.
.
commit
|
commitdiff
|
tree
2024-03-28
Chris Ro
b
inson
Process 4 sample
s
at a time in PhaseShi
f
terT
:
:pr
o
c
e
s
s
commit
|
commitdiff
|
tree
2024-03-28
Chris Robinson
Use
th
e
proper
size for the s
p
a
n
s i
n
uhje
n
code
r
commit
|
commitdiff
|
tree
2024-03-28
Chr
i
s Rob
i
nson
Support m
o
no input f
i
les in u
h
jencoder
commit
|
commitdiff
|
tree
2024-03-26
Chri
s
R
ob
i
nson
A
void repeating the
r
eturn type
commit
|
commitdiff
|
tree
2024-03-26
Chris
R
obinson
M
ake an
operator
bool explicit
commit
|
commitdiff
|
tree
2024-03-26
Chri
s
Robinson
Return
a vector of s
t
rings for
e
n
umeration from the
.
.
.
commit
|
commitdiff
|
tree
2024-03-25
Chris Robinson
Suppress warni
n
gs
a
b
out using hardware_int
e
rfer
e
n
c
e_size
commit
|
commitdiff
|
tree
2024-03-25
Chri
s
Robinson
Fix value
t
r
u
ncation
warning
commit
|
commitdiff
|
tree
2024-03-25
Chris Ro
b
inson
Change
a
coupl
e
st
r
i
n
g li
t
era
l
s to string_view literals
commit
|
commitdiff
|
tree
2024-03-25
C
h
ris R
o
binso
n
D
o
n't try to sort
an empty
l
ist
commit
|
commitdiff
|
tree
2024-03-24
Chris Robinson
Remove an unused
initializer
commit
|
commitdiff
|
tree
2024-03-24
C
h
ris Rob
i
ns
o
n
Simplify
c
alculating
the
9
0-degree phase sh
i
f
t
FIR
.
.
.
commit
|
commitdiff
|
tree
2024-03-24
Chris Robinso
n
Avoid poin
t
er ar
i
t
hmetic
w
ith HRTF
s
to
r
age
commit
|
commitdiff
|
tree
2024-03-24
Ch
r
is
R
obinso
n
A
v
oid pointer ari
t
hmetic with
nea
r
-field filter mixing
commit
|
commitdiff
|
tree
2024-03-24
C
h
ris Rob
i
nson
Fix
u
hjenco
d
er's fallback channel IDs
commit
|
commitdiff
|
tree
2024-03-23
C
hri
s
Robi
n
son
Use a more appropriate
typ
e
for an array of
f
set
commit
|
commitdiff
|
tree
2024-03-23
Ch
r
is Ro
b
i
n
son
Remove unused getopt
commit
|
commitdiff
|
tree
2024-03-23
Chris Robinson
Avoid point
e
r arit
h
m
etic
in sofa-i
n
fo
and makemh
r
commit
|
commitdiff
|
tree
2024-03-21
Chris Rob
i
nson
P
ro
t
ect effect slot state changes with the effect slot
.
.
.
commit
|
commitdiff
|
tree
2024-03-21
Chris Robinson
Don't over-alloca
t
e the a
c
t
i
ve effect slot a
r
ray
commit
|
commitdiff
|
tree
2024-03-21
Chris Robinson
Avoid
r
aw poin
t
ers in u
h
jdeco
d
er/uhjenco
d
er
commit
|
commitdiff
|
tree
2024-03-21
Chris R
o
b
i
nson
Recognize
_M_A
R
M6
4
in PF
F
FT
f
or MSVC NEON sup
p
ort
commit
|
commitdiff
|
tree
2024-03-20
Chris Robin
s
on
Use sp
a
ns
a
bit more in place of po
i
nt
e
rs
commit
|
commitdiff
|
tree
2024-03-18
C
hris Robinson
Clean up some more raw pointer a
r
i
t
hmetic
commit
|
commitdiff
|
tree
2024-03-17
C
h
ris Robi
n
son
Avoid p
o
inters
f
o
r
calculati
n
g B-Format upsampler matrix
commit
|
commitdiff
|
tree
2024-03-17
Chr
i
s Robins
o
n
M
a
ke
a
span'
s
c
o
ntents co
n
st
commit
|
commitdiff
|
tree
2024-03-17
Chris Robinson
Avo
i
d so
m
e more di
r
e
c
t
p
oint
e
r
manipulat
i
on
commit
|
commitdiff
|
tree
2024-03-16
Chris Robins
o
n
Mark some conditionall
y
-used param
e
t
e
rs as
maybe_unuse
d
commit
|
commitdiff
|
tree
2024-03-16
Ch
r
i
s
Robin
s
on
Add a pointer wrapper for al::
s
pan
'
s itera
t
ors
commit
|
commitdiff
|
tree
2024-03-16
C
hris Robinso
n
Workaroun
d
l
i
bc
+
+
d
e
f
i
n
in
g
_
_
cpp_l
i
b_
h
ardwa
r
e_interferenc
e
_si
z
e
commit
|
commitdiff
|
tree
2024-03-15
C
hris Robinson
Don't pass an iterator
where a pointer is expected
commit
|
commitdiff
|
tree
2024-03-15
Chris Rob
i
ns
o
n
Make
a
n
o
ther global variable inline
commit
|
commitdiff
|
tree
2024-03-15
Chris Robinson
Avoid some
more direct poin
t
er manip
u
lat
i
on
commit
|
commitdiff
|
tree
2024-03-14
Chri
s
Robi
n
son
A
v
o
id some pointer
a
r
ithmetic
commit
|
commitdiff
|
tree
2024-03-14
Chris Robinson
Use mor
e
con
s
isten
t
paramet
e
r na
m
e
s
commit
|
commitdiff
|
tree
2024-03-14
Chris Robinson
Handle
AL erro
r
s more consistentl
y
commit
|
commitdiff
|
tree
2024-03-13
Ch
r
is Robinson
Use exception
s
fo
r
ef
f
ect slot errors
commit
|
commitdiff
|
tree
2024-03-13
C
h
ris Rob
i
nson
Us
e
exceptions to handl
e
bu
f
f
e
r errors
commit
|
commitdiff
|
tree
2024-03-12
C
h
ris Robinson
Move s
o
me fu
n
ction defi
n
itions to a more appr
o
p
r
iate
.
.
.
commit
|
commitdiff
|
tree
2024-03-12
Chris Robinson
Mark a
function maybe_unused
t
hat'
s
only
u
sed in asserts
commit
|
commitdiff
|
tree
2024-03-12
Chris Robinso
n
Make su
r
e a needed header is
i
ncluded
commit
|
commitdiff
|
tree
2024-03-12
Chris Robi
n
son
Avoid us
i
n
g preexistin
g
en
u
m values
commit
|
commitdiff
|
tree
2024-03-12
Chris Robinson
Avoid s
o
m
e
p
oi
n
t
er arit
h
metic
commit
|
commitdiff
|
tree
2024-03-11
C
h
r
is Robinson
R
ecognize the s
y
stem device na
m
e
for PipeWire and PulseAudio
commit
|
commitdiff
|
tree
2024-03-10
Chris Robinso
n
Use a subspan ins
t
ead of
p
ointer manipulati
o
n
commit
|
commitdiff
|
tree
2024-03-10
Chris
R
o
b
inson
Fi
x
ringbuffer overflow
check
commit
|
commitdiff
|
tree
2024-03-10
Chris Robinson
S
i
mplify generating I
D
s
commit
|
commitdiff
|
tree
2024-03-09
Chris Robinso
n
Use
s
pan's iterators for FlexArray
commit
|
commitdiff
|
tree
2024-03-09
Chri
s
Ro
b
inson
Use a span fo
r
the distance compensati
o
n buffer
commit
|
commitdiff
|
tree
2024-03-09
C
h
ris
Rob
i
ns
o
n
Avo
i
d so
m
e
more raw pointers
commit
|
commitdiff
|
tree
next